The applicant seeks special leave to appeal from a decision of the Court of Appeal of the Supreme Court of Victoria (Kyrou, Sifris and Kennedy JJA) unanimously allowing an appeal from a decision of the County Court of Victoria (Judge Burchell).
The application raises no question of public importance, concerning as it does the application of well-settled principles in relation to interpretation of a specific provision of the Instruments Act 1958 (Vic). Moreover, the application has insufficient prospects of success to warrant the grant of special leave to appeal. Special leave should be refused.
Pursuant to r 41.08.1 of the High Court Rules 2004 (Cth), we direct the Registrar to draw up, sign and seal an order dismissing the application with costs.
